#068ba0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#068ba0 is composed of 2.4% red, 54.5%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 188.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 32.5%. #068ba0 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#001741.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#068ba0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#068ba0 has RGB values of R:6, G:139,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 428960.

Shades and Tints of #068ba0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000809 is the darkest color, while #f5f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#068ba0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535353 is the less saturated color, while #068ba0 is the most saturated one.
